Fitbit Advertising Strategy: What Makes Their Ads Work

Fitbit's advertising strategy focuses on demonstrating ecosystem value rather than just hardware specifications. While they still promote core products like the Fitbit Sense 2 and unique accessories like Tooled Straps, the most high-impact campaigns center on software innovation. The most impressive ad sets revolve around the recent debut of the Gemini-powered AI health coach, which dominated impressions across Meta platforms. This signals a strategic pivot toward ecosystem services built into the wearable platform. This approach positions Fitbit not just as a device vendor, but as a holistic wellness partner, a necessary differentiation against rivals like Garmin Vivosmart. The success of these announcement campaigns showcases how crucial timely news integration is to successful Fitbit advertising.

Key lessons in their strategy involve segmenting product messaging effectively. Low-volume campaigns are used to test market interest in specific segments, such as Gut Health Capsules, focusing on intimate wellness messaging like “Support your gut. Support your wellness.” By contrast, the high-volume campaigns utilize authoritative CTAs like “Learn More” rather than just “Shop Now,” aiming for education and massive top-of-funnel reach. This dual approach allows them to cover both niche health products and broad tech announcements simultaneously. Fitbit Facebook and Instagram Ads: Platform Analysis

Analyzing the distribution of high-volume campaigns shows that Fitbit uses Meta platforms as the primary vehicle for mass awareness. The highest performing campaigns, specifically promoting the Google Gemini-powered AI health coach, accrued massive impressions—560,276 on Facebook and 554,315 on Instagram. This strong, consistent performance highlights that both Fitbit Facebook ads and Fitbit Instagram ads are essential tools for immediate, high-saturation brand visibility and important announcements.

Secondary campaigns targeting specific health outcomes, such as the Gut Health Capsules, also ran heavily on both Facebook and Instagram, although these generated significantly lower impressions (averaging around 4,300 per ad placement). This suggests these were likely highly targeted retargeting or interest-based campaigns focused on conversion rather than awareness. Interestingly, a campaign leveraging the Fitbit name, advertising a 'Fitbit, but for cats,' successfully generated over 626,000 combined impressions across Facebook placements, illustrating the powerful brand equity that Fitbit holds in the general health monitoring space. By contrast, accessory promotions (e.g., Sense 2 straps) were primarily relegated to smaller platforms like AdMob, only generating around 4,800 impressions, demonstrating that Meta is reserved for campaigns with the highest strategic value.

Fitbit Ad Copy Examples and Messaging Themes

Examining successful Fitbit ad examples reveals two distinct messaging themes correlating directly to campaign goals: news-driven awareness and emotional wellness. The awareness campaigns utilize authority and news hooks, as seen in the highest-impression headline: "Google debuts Gemini-powered AI health coach for Fitbit and Pixel Watch users." This copy leverages partnerships and urgency to drive high-volume informational clicks ("Learn More"). This strategy is highly effective in attracting early adopters and tech journalists.

Conversion-focused copy, often found in smaller supplement campaigns, utilizes emotional language and promises immediate physical benefits. Examples include: "Support your gut. Support your wellness," and the highly evocative "Feel Lighter Every Day 🌿." The consistent use of the leaf emoji (🌿) across multiple placements, including videos and images, is a strategic visual cue that communicates natural, gentle health support. The primary call-to-action for these direct product campaigns is overwhelmingly "Shop Now," reinforcing immediate purchase intent. These conversion-focused examples offer valuable insights when benchmarked against rivals like Xiaomi Mi Band, which often focuses more on technical specifications in their marketing materials.

What Marketers Can Learn from Fitbit's Ads

The observed patterns in Fitbit marketing provide several crucial takeaways for marketers operating in the competitive health and fitness technology sector. The data confirms the powerful synergy between strategic software partnerships and digital ad spending; the most effective campaigns were those announcing high-profile AI integrations. Compared to competitors focused heavily on hardware durability, Fitbit successfully markets intangible assets—data analysis, personalized coaching, and overall wellness—as primary value propositions, moving the conversation beyond just the device itself. This approach builds a strong moat around their ecosystem.

Here are key lessons derived from analyzing their recent performance:

  1. Prioritize Software Announcements: Use major integrations (like AI) for high-volume Meta campaigns to dominate impression share and validate premium pricing.
  2. Maintain Niche Segments: Run small-scale, highly targeted campaigns for ancillary health products (Gut Health Capsules) to test diversification outside of core hardware sales.
  3. Use Differentiated CTAs: Clearly delineate between informational campaigns ("Learn More" for AI) and transactional ones ("Shop Now" for products) to optimize the sales funnel.
  4. Leverage Brand Recognition: Understand that the brand name “Fitbit” is synonymous with health tracking, allowing third parties to leverage the comparison to frame their own unique offerings ("It's like Fitbit, but for cats").
